scope:
The present document defines Net Assist Protocol 2 that is optimized for TETRA air interface. It defines services:
- allowing information to be passed to a location determining entity also called MS (Mobile Station);
- allowing a location determining entity to request assistance information to an assistance server.
The information passed to the location determining entity by the assistance server, when relevant, reflects the content and format of the equivalent information (navigation data) which passes from satellites to the location determining entity.
The protocol is capable of supporting more than one position determining technology. Presently it covers multiple GNSS, and is extensible to all network positioning methods.
